    What to do if my Simplicity Broadmoor 22HP Tractor engine will not turnover or start?
    • D
      Dawn HicksAug 14, 2025
      If your Simplicity Tractor's engine won't turn over or start, it could be due to several reasons. First, ensure the brake pedal is fully depressed. Check that the PTO (electric clutch) switch is in the OFF position and the cruise control is disengaged (NEUTRAL/OFF position). Make sure you have enough fuel; if the engine is hot, let it cool before refilling. If the engine is flooded, disengage the choke. Also, the battery might be discharged or dead, requiring a recharge or replacement. Visually inspect the wiring for any loose or broken connections. For issues like a blown fuse, faulty solenoid or starter motor, faulty safety interlock switch, water in the fuel, or old gas, it's best to consult an authorized dealer.

    Why does my Simplicity Broadmoor 22HP Tractor engine stall when I engage the mower?
    • G
      George HigginsAug 17, 2025
      If your Simplicity Tractor engine stalls easily with the mower engaged, try the following: First, ensure the engine speed is set to full throttle and reduce your ground speed. If the air filter is dirty or clogged, consult the Engine Manual. If the cutting height is set too low, especially in tall grass, raise it to the maximum height for the first pass. Make sure the discharge chute isn't jamming by directing it towards the previously cut area. Allow the engine to warm up for several minutes before engaging the mower, and start the mower in a cleared area.

    What to do if my Simplicity Broadmoor 22HP Tractor runs, but won't drive?
    • D
      Dillon HughesAug 25, 2025
      If your Simplicity Tractor runs, but won't drive, make sure the ground speed control pedals are depressed and the transmission release lever is in the DRIVE position, and that the parking brake is disengaged. If the problem persists, the traction drive belt may be broken or slipping, in which case you should see an authorized dealer.

    Why does my Simplicity Broadmoor 22HP Tractor have excessive oil consumption?
    • K
      kimberlyterrySep 3, 2025
      If your Simplicity Tractor is consuming excessive oil, it could be due to the engine running too hot, using the wrong grade of oil, or having too much oil in the crankcase. For an overheating engine or incorrect oil grade, consult the Engine Manual or an authorized dealer. If there's too much oil, drain the excess.

    Why does my Simplicity Broadmoor 22HP Tractor steer hard?
    • Y
      Yvonne NicholsonSep 6, 2025
      If your Simplicity Tractor steers hard or handles poorly, it could be due to loose steering linkage, improper tire inflation, or dry front wheel spindle bearings. For loose steering linkage or dry spindle bearings, consult an authorized dealer. Check the tire pressure, consulting the Check Tire Pressure section.
